WebJan 19, 2024 · Divide the watts of your cordless drill’s motor by the total number of volts on the battery. This will give you the amperage draw of the drill. For example, an 18v cordless drill with a 250-watt motor will draw about 14 amps. Now, let’s say your battery is rated 3Ah. Remember that a 3Ah battery will draw1 amp for 3 hours. WebFor example, a 16-amp power tool on a 120-volt circuit draws 1,920 watts (16x120=1,920). That same tool on a 240-volt circuit now runs at 8 amps and still consumes 1,920 watts (8x240=1,920).
